Tasting Notes

Deep colour. Young, expressive nose showing a bouquet of red and black fruits and floral undertones. Supple mouthfeel with soft stuffing, melted tannins and notable fruit. A good classic Cahors that is already very enjoyable.

The Producer

Château de Gaudou

Château de Gaudou sits in Vire-sur-Lot (along the Lot River in the southwest, a few hours inland from Bordeaux) amidst a handful of Cahors’ other prestigious vineyard terroirs. This mythical location is referred to as “The Beverly Hills of the Cahors Appellation”, by notable wine critic Michele Bettane. Most vines on the estate are considered “old vine stock” and remarkably some are still on original rootstock that was planted as far back as the late 1800’s!

Winemaker Fabrice Durou is the 7th generation to continue his family’s winemaking tradition in Cahors. Fabrice has evolved a ‘Cru’ based philosophy with each vintage of little known discovery making today's bottle, a very special find at a price that blows our minds.
